From the LOA Survey • Notes: • Agilent only enters non PFL or disability leaves into HRIS • Intel leaves hold “pending status” marker until 1st day of leave, at which point they become “active leave” • KLA enters all leaves (except PLOA) with FMLA default until instructed otherwise. • VeriSign does not enter LOAs into HRIS • Less than a third of mbrs do “non-specific” coding. Generally those who code for MLOA also code for PLOA (note exceptions) • Some additional coding for pd/not pd
